The Little Green Cafe opens doors on Museum Road

This organic cafe serves healthy bites, brews and guilt-free desserts 

Images of dishes on Instagram with hashtags #eatclean #eathealthy have been alluring foodies across the globe. Even Bengaluru is witnessing a sudden spurt in the number of ‘health’ cafes. The newest entrant into the green army is the Little Green Cafe on Museum Road. 
Little Green Cafe (a proactive Instagrammer, we’re told), is from the team behind Green Theory. The place has pulled out all the stops at cutting down its carbon footprint. A note on the table specifies that the cafe uses only 60-watt LED bulbs, and  has used chemical-free paints and upcycled teak wood for the interiors. 

Bakes and broths
We started our elaborate meal with Mushroom Cappuccino from the soup section. This one has nothing to do with coffee, apart from the foam and froth. The rich and creamy texture enhances the flavour of the mushrooms.

Next, from the long list of appetisers, we chose the Semolina waffles with mint chutney and tomato relish. The heart-shaped waffles seemed to have been made with much love. Stuffed with corn and capsicum, these freshly baked waffles paired excellently with both the mint chutney and the tomato relish (salsa). A must-try on a rainy afternoon.

God’s own choice
For main course, we chose the peculiar combination of Thai curry (green) with semi-polished Kerala rice. The Thai Curry was comforting with its fusion of spicy and slightly sweet flavours. We also opted for the Raw papaya and soba noodles salad with Som Tum dressing. 
The medley of hot and tangy notes added a hint of drama to our meal. Watch out for bits of bird’s eye chilli! In dire need of something sweet, we asked for the Chocolate mousse with granola.

A scoop of mousse made with dark chocolate and yoghurt (instead of cream) is placed on a bed of granola and topped with meringue and dusted with chocolate. This one too was impressive.
What makes the Little Garden Cafe worth a visit is their unpretentiousness. Right from the ambiance and food to the service, they put their best foot forward. 
Rs 1,400 for two. At Museum Road. Details: 48544183
